Monkey business as horde of simians swarm photographer in Thailand


A photographer visiting Lopburi in Thailand was mobbed by a pack of wild monkeys on July 14.

Footage shows the overwhelmed man struggling to move as six monkeys climb on his shoulders and back.

The cheeky apes can be seen later playing with a camera tripod and eventually knocking it over.

''Lopburi is known as the monkey capital of Thailand, the monkeys run will here, however they are very naughty. Two people lost their reading glasses while I was visiting there today, and the monkeys ran away with them. I almost lost mine too,'' the photographer said.
